Das Kopieren von Ubuntu 9.04 auf eine MicroSD-Karte ist langsam

0

Wenn ich etwas auf meine 16 GB-Micro-SD-Karte der Klasse 6 kopiere, scheint es sehr langsam zu sein. Dies gilt für mehrere Lesegeräte und Computer, ich habe es jedoch nur mit Ubuntu 9.04 getestet. In / var / log / messages erhalte ich während der Übertragung einige Male Folgendes:

[355335.112041] usb 1-4: reset high speed USB device using ehci_hcd and address 3
[355368.112060] usb 1-4: reset high speed USB device using ehci_hcd and address 3
[355403.116565] usb 1-4: reset high speed USB device using ehci_hcd and address 3
[355436.112041] usb 1-4: reset high speed USB device using ehci_hcd and address 3
[355470.112311] usb 1-4: reset high speed USB device using ehci_hcd and address 3
[355534.112403] usb 1-4: reset high speed USB device using ehci_hcd and address 3

Ist das eine schlechte Karte, ich könnte es mit einem anderen Betriebssystem versuchen, aber vielleicht hat jemand dies gesehen? Ich kopiere auf die erste Partition, die Partition sieht so aus:

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1               1        1822    14635183+   b  W95 FAT32
/dev/sdb2            1823        1920      787185   83  Linux
/dev/sdb3            1921        1953      265072+  82  Linux swap / Solaris
Kyle Brandt
quelle
Können Sie die Ausgabe zur Verfügung stellen lspci, lsusbund cat /proc/scsi/scsiwenn der Leser angeschlossen ist?
Nagul
Nagul, danke für die Hilfe. Ich entschied, dass die Karte durcheinander ist, konnte nicht einmal Partitionen mit mehreren Lesern und Hosts löschen. Neue Karte kam, scheint gut zu funktionieren.
Kyle Brandt

Antworten:

1

Haben Sie andere Karten in den gleichen Lesegeräten ausprobiert und Übertragungsgeschwindigkeiten erreicht? Es konnte keiner der Leser die höchsten Übertragungsgeschwindigkeiten unterstützen.

Soweit ich weiß, könnte das Zurücksetzen eine fehlerhafte Karte, ein fehlerhafter Leser oder ein fehlerhafter USB-Anschluss sein. Die USB- oder Kartenverbindung kann aufgrund von Lüftervibrationen vom Computer zeitweise unterbrochen werden. Es können auch Treiber sein, auf mehreren Computern ist dies jedoch unwahrscheinlich (es sei denn, es handelt sich ausschließlich um Dell).

Joshua Nurczyk
quelle
1

Haben Sie ein älteres Motherboard mit einer älteren USB-Version? Möglicherweise liegt ein Kompatibilitätsproblem mit der älteren (langsamen) USB-Schnittstelle vor, die auf ein Gerät mit einer schnellen USB-Karte übertragen wird.

sudesh
quelle
0

Ich hätte nicht gedacht, dass Ubuntu eine SD-Karte im SD-Modus verwenden könnte - ich dachte, es würde den älteren MMC-Modus verwenden, da Linux die Einschränkungen des SD-Konsortiums im SD-Modus nicht einhalten kann.

Kurzfassung: Schuld an der Entwicklung von SD, nicht von Ubuntu.

Bearbeiten: Ich stehe korrigiert - Benutzer verwendet einen SD-Leser über USB, nicht einen in die Maschine eingebauten SD-Leser.

Broam
quelle
Das ist völlig falsch. Erstens spricht Linux bei Verwendung eines USB-Lesegeräts (was hier der Fall ist) nicht das SD-Protokoll, sondern das öffentlich dokumentierte "USB-Speicher" -Protokoll (es ist das Kartenlesegerät selbst, das das SD-Protokoll implementiert). Zweitens ist die erforderliche Dokumentation seit Jahren nicht mehr verfügbar (check commit 335eadf auf dem Linux-Kernel - es ist aus dem Jahr 2005).
CesarB